diff --git a/crates/turbopack/src/rebase/mod.rs b/crates/turbopack/src/rebase/mod.rs index de60990a40f13..bb74be2b474c7 100644 --- a/crates/turbopack/src/rebase/mod.rs +++ b/crates/turbopack/src/rebase/mod.rs @@ -52,14 +52,11 @@ impl OutputAsset for RebasedAsset { async fn references(&self) -> Result> { let mut references = Vec::new(); for &module in all_referenced_modules(self.source).await?.iter() { - references.push(Vc::upcast( - RebasedAsset { - source: module, - input_dir: self.input_dir, - output_dir: self.output_dir, - } - .cell(), - )); + references.push(Vc::upcast(RebasedAsset::new( + module, + self.input_dir, + self.output_dir, + ))); } Ok(Vc::cell(references)) }